Jiri Prochazka made his successful debut in the UFC at UFC 251. Now, in his latest fight, the newcomer has defeated his latest opponent, Dominick Reyes, by a spinning elbow, which surely is a knockout-of-the-year candidate.

The KO has seen MMA fans pay a lot of attention to the Czech Republic native. They are eager to know more about the new light heavyweight contender.

Prochazka joined RT Sport MMA, where he revealed something that was unheard of before. ‘Denisa’ said, “I am living in a forest and next to the lake in Bruno. And I like to live more alone, but I want to share my ideology and my ideas and my style of fighting.”

Jiri Prochazka continued, “So I need to be a little bit famous… Now for my career that’s important to be like that, to be alone and just practice and practice because I can stay pure clean and without no distraction, no relationship.”

Jiri Prochazka has his focus on the UFC gold

The UFC light heavyweight is living a lonely life in the middle of the forest. It came in as a surprise for many people, but ‘Denisa’ has his reasons to live alone. This focus has helped him rise to #3 in the UFC rankings after just two fights in the promotion.

Prochazka wants to capture the UFC gold. The current champion, Jan Blachowicz, is scheduled to fight Glover Teixeira for the light heavyweight title at UFC 266. Therefore, Jiri Prochazka can only fight for the title after the event gets over.

Jan Blachowicz has promised ‘Denisa’ a crack at his tile after he is done with Teixeira. ‘The Polish Power’ tweeted “Me vs you in Cieszyn Prince vs Samurai Sword vs Katana #LegendaryPolishPower.”

Given the timelines, the UFC could book ‘Denisa’ against another ranked light heavyweight, potentially Aleksandar Rakic.
